Shehadeh launches investment plan for Ajloun

By JT - Nov 08,2017 - Last updated at Nov 09,2017

AMMAN — Minister of State for Investment Affairs Muhannad Shehadeh on Tuesday inaugurated the investment plan for Ajloun governorate, the Jordan News Agency, Petra, reported.

Attended by representatives of the public and private sectors at the Youth Camp, Shehadeh said that the launch of the plan aims at identifying projects that fit the touristic, environmental and agricultural conservation in Ajloun, in order to distribute the development gains fairly and improve the living standards of the citizens.

He pointed out that preliminary feasibility studies were carried out for a number of industries at an estimated cost of JD1 million, including a production and distillation factory for aromatic and medicinal plant oils, marble manufacturing, a natural juice factory, among other investment projects.
